?Original VAST
Original VAST finds structures that are similar to individual protein molecules, or individual 3D domains, in your query structure. Select a protein molecule ("chain") or 3D domain of interest from the table below to view a list of other proteins or domains that have a similar 3D shape. In contrast to VAST+, which focuses on the default biological unit, Original VAST lists all protein molecules in the asymmetric unit of the query structure.
